Where is Grass Valley?
Grass Valley is found in East Oakland. It sits in the hills, just east of two well-known spots: Bishop O'Dowd High School and the famous Oakland Zoo. Imagine it as being tucked away in a scenic, elevated area.
Key Locations Nearby
The neighborhood is built around upper Golf Links Road. It's also just west of where Skyline Road ends. If you're looking for a fun outdoor activity, the Lake Chabot Golf Course is right next door. This makes Grass Valley a perfect spot for those who love nature and outdoor sports.
Grass Valley Elementary School
A very important part of the Grass Valley community is its elementary school. Grass Valley Elementary School opened its doors in 1953.
